Cadw sites offer wonderful spaces to visit in great locations across the country. Widening access to heritage and culture is a priority for Cadw.

Find a site near you – be it staffed with facilities or an open site – and connect with Welsh heritage. Explore the history and stories on your own or with friends, family or another group. However you come, you are welcome.

Boost your mental wellbeing by getting creative, exploring nature or just enjoying the calmness of the spaces and the echoes of the past that resonate in the stones around you on your own.

Cadw has a range of concessions and supported offers to help enable access to individuals and groups, as well as regular paid entry and membership offers. Cadw also offers a range of events and activities, and they support award-winning volunteering too.
